The Jersey City Medical Center's EMS Department provides Advanced Life Support (ALS) Coverage for Greater Hudson County which includes Jersey City, Bayonne, Guttenberg, Hoboken, North Bergen, Secaucus, Union City, Weehawken and West New York. All of our ALS units are equipped with:
-
2 NJ Certified Paramedics
-
Life Pak 12 EKG Monitors & Defibrillators
-
Intravenous Access & EZIO Intraosseous Access
-
Endotracheal Intubation & Combitube Backup Airways
-
Chest Decompression Kits
-
UHF, VHF & NEXTEL communications with the Medical Command Physician including 12 Lead Transmission
-
Temperature Controlled Vehicles and IV Fluid Warming Kits
-
Over 30 medications
-
A Full Set of Back Up Equipment for Multiple Patients
Mobile Intensive Care units are manned 24 hours a day by Paramedics. These individuals undergo an intensive program of study covering all areas of emergency cardiac care and trauma management. They are also certified by the American Heart Association in Advanced Cardiac Life Support. Continuous training updates these dedicated individuals to state-of-the-art technology.
In addition to Basic Life Support skills, the Paramedic can perform complex diagnosis and medical procedures: cardiac monitoring, defibrillation, administration of specific medications and solutions, initiation of IV therapy and intubation. By bringing these professionals quickly and directly to the ill or injured patient, morbidity and mortality are greatly reduced.
Our Paramedics operate under a combination of Standing Orders and On-Line Medical Command. Medical Command is provided by Board Certified Emergency Physicians via a state of the art Carepoint communications system that includes voice, telemetry (single & 12- lead) and is even able to receive pictures from the field.
